Alcohol-based flux

EO-B-024C (Multiflux)

Recommended method of application

Wave, selective and manual soldering processes, strand tinning

No Clean alcohol-based flux, Multi-Flux
Di-carboxylic acid complex, contains resin additive, halide-free (WEEE/RoHS compliant)
Type ISO-9454: 2231 (2.2.3.A) // DIN-EN 61190-1-1 (acc. to J-STD004B) (IEC ORL0)

Cat. no. 6147

Technical data

Appearance:light yellow, clear liquid
Hazardous goods:Yes
Solids content:4.0 wt.-%
Acid value:29 - 34 mg KOH/g
Halogenide-free:Yes
Resinous:Yes
Available as a concentrate:Yes
Density at 20 °C:0.796 (+/- 0.003) g/ml
Flash point:12 °C
Durability:12 months
Storage conditions:cool, dry and protected from light at 5 - 25 °C
Working temperature:Room temperature (normally 20 - 25 °C)

Description

Multi-Flux EO-B-024C was developed for wave, selective and hand soldering processes as well as strand tinning and is a latest generation no-clean flux. It contains special activators that additionally strengthen the soldering process. It can be applied using all standard application methods (except foaming). The solids content is 4 wt.-% and is corrosion-free. This flux is very versatile and OSP-compatible. It delivers good results in wave, selective and hand soldering as well as in cable assembly/wire tinning. The generally applicable rule of keeping applied flux quantities as low as possible also applies to this product. For further information on ingredients (hazardous substances), safe handling, storage, transportation and disposal, please refer to the current safety data sheet (SDS, SDS, MSDS).

Spray fluxes: First set the flux dosage to 15 - 30 ml/min. and ensure even distribution (test with thermal paper if necessary). Then correct to the optimum quantity.
Preheating: A preheating temperature of 80 - 110 °C is recommended for "simple" PCBs and 100 - 130 °C for "more complex" PCBs. It can be used in both leaded and lead-free solder systems.
